Gardening is a rewarding hobby, bringing joy and fresh produce to many households. However, it also presents challenges, and amongst the most persistent are garden pests. Slugs and snails, in particular, can wreak havoc on seedlings, vegetables, and beloved flowers. Protecting your garden from these slimy invaders requires vigilance and a proactive approach. Fortunately, resources like slugwatch.co.uk provide invaluable insights into understanding slug behavior, identifying vulnerable plants, and implementing effective control measures. This dedicated platform helps gardeners stay one step ahead, ensuring a healthier and more productive outdoor space.

The impact of slugs and snails extends beyond simply nibbled leaves. They can transmit diseases to plants, reducing yields and even causing plant death. Understanding the life cycle of these pests and the conditions that favor their proliferation is crucial for effective management. Factors like damp weather, readily available food sources, and sheltered habitats contribute to slug and snail populations. By recognizing these elements, gardeners can modify their environments and implement targeted strategies to minimize damage and nurture thriving gardens. Preventative measures are often more effective—and less damaging to beneficial wildlife—than relying solely on reactive treatments.

Understanding Slug and Snail Behavior

Slugs and snails aren’t random destroyers; their behavior is driven by specific needs and preferences. They are primarily nocturnal feeders, emerging from their hiding places after dark to feast on tender plant tissues. This is why damage is often most apparent in the morning. They are also highly attracted to damp environments, as they require moisture to survive. Gardeners often unintentionally create ideal slug habitats by overwatering or providing excessive ground cover. Understanding their preferred food sources is also essential – many slugs show a particular fondness for hostas, lettuce, and other leafy greens. Observing the patterns of damage in your garden can provide clues about the types of slugs present and their favored plants, helping you tailor your control strategies accordingly.

The Role of Environmental Factors

The success of any slug control program is heavily influenced by the surrounding environment. Prolonged periods of wet weather significantly boost slug populations, providing them with the moisture they need to thrive and reproduce. Conversely, dry spells can force them to seek refuge in deeper, more sheltered locations. Similarly, the type of soil in your garden can impact slug activity. Heavy clay soils tend to retain more moisture, creating a more hospitable environment than well-drained sandy soils. Mulching, while beneficial for plant health, can also provide shelter for slugs if not managed carefully. Creating a less inviting habitat through improved drainage, careful mulching practices, and regular weeding can significantly reduce slug numbers.

Effective Slug Control Strategies

There’s no single ‘silver bullet’ for slug control; a combination of methods is usually the most effective. Organic gardeners often favor non-toxic approaches, such as handpicking slugs during their nocturnal feeding sprees. While time-consuming, this is a very targeted method and doesn’t harm beneficial insects. Beer traps are another popular option – slugs are attracted to the yeast in beer and become trapped in the container, ultimately drowning. However, be aware that these traps also attract slugs from surrounding areas, potentially exacerbating the problem. Copper tape, when applied around plant pots or raised beds, creates a barrier that slugs are reluctant to cross, due to the reaction between their slime and the copper. Other physical barriers, like grit or crushed eggshells, can also provide some protection.

Integrated Pest Management (IPM)

Integrated Pest Management focuses on long-term prevention and minimizing reliance on chemical controls. It involves a holistic approach, combining cultural practices, biological controls, and targeted treatments. Cultural practices include things like sanitation (removing debris where slugs hide), improving drainage, and selecting slug-resistant plant varieties. Biological controls utilize natural predators of slugs, such as birds, hedgehogs, frogs, and ground beetles. Encouraging these beneficial creatures in your garden can help keep slug populations in check. Nematodes are microscopic worms that parasitize slugs and are increasingly used as a biological control agent. Finally, targeted treatments, like organic slug pellets, should be used as a last resort, and applied carefully to minimize harm to non-target species.

  • Handpicking: Effective for small gardens, best done at night with a flashlight
  • Beer Traps: Simple to set up, requires regular emptying
  • Copper Tape: Provides a barrier, needs replacing when tarnished
  • Nematodes: Biological control, requires specific application conditions
  • Organic Pellets: Use sparingly, choose pet-safe formulations

Protecting Vulnerable Plants

Certain plants are particularly susceptible to slug damage. Hostas, with their large, tender leaves, are a favorite target. Lettuce, seedlings of all kinds, and many flowering plants are also at risk. Protecting these vulnerable plants requires extra attention. Raising plants in seed trays or small pots until they are more established can give them a head start. Using cloches or protective netting can create a physical barrier against slugs. Companion planting – growing plants that deter slugs alongside vulnerable species – is another effective technique. For example, garlic and onions are believed to repel slugs, while rosemary and thyme can create a less hospitable environment. Choosing slug-resistant varieties of your favorite plants can also reduce the likelihood of damage.

Creating a Slug-Resistant Garden Design

The layout of your garden can also influence slug activity. Avoid creating sheltered, damp corners where slugs can thrive. Ensure good air circulation by pruning plants and allowing space between them. Consider using raised beds, as they provide a physical barrier and improve drainage. Hard landscaping features, such as paths and patios, can also disrupt slug movement. Using gravel or bark mulch around plants can deter slugs, as they find it difficult to navigate. By incorporating these design principles, you can create a garden that is less attractive to slugs and more resilient to their damage. A well-designed garden isn’t just aesthetically pleasing; it’s also a proactive defense against pests.

The Impact of Soil Health on Slug Populations

The health of your soil plays a significant role in the overall resilience of your garden, including its susceptibility to slug infestations. Healthy soil is rich in organic matter, has good drainage, and supports a diverse community of beneficial organisms. These organisms, such as bacteria, fungi, and earthworms, help to break down organic matter, releasing nutrients that plants need to grow strong and resist pest damage. Well-nourished plants are better able to withstand slug attacks. Improving soil health also creates a more favorable environment for slug predators, such as ground beetles and hedgehogs. Regularly amending your soil with compost, manure, or other organic materials can significantly improve its health and reduce slug problems.

Furthermore, understanding the pH level of your soil is vital. Slugs prefer alkaline conditions. Adjusting your soil to a slightly acidic pH can make it less appealing to them. Soil testing kits are readily available and can provide valuable insights into soil composition. Consistently building and maintaining healthy soil isn't just about slug control; it’s a foundation for a flourishing garden, promoting robust plant growth and reducing the need for intervention altogether.
